The 5-Second Trick For rtp

The packet is then sent into multicast tree that connects together many of the individuals in the session. The reception report consists of a number of fields, The main of which can be outlined under.

The transceiver's path is ready to "sendrecv", indicating that it need to resume each sending and obtaining audio.

RFC 3550 RTP July 2003 to deliver the data required by a selected software and may usually be built-in into the applying processing instead of staying carried out as being a individual layer. RTP can be a protocol framework that is definitely deliberately not entire. This document specifies those features envisioned to become common across the many programs for which RTP would be ideal. Unlike traditional protocols through which extra functions might be accommodated by building the protocol more general or by incorporating a possibility mechanism that will call for parsing, RTP is meant to generally be tailor-made as a result of modifications and/or additions for the headers as wanted. Illustrations are specified in Sections five.three and six.4.3. For that reason, In combination with this doc, a whole specification of RTP for a certain application will require a number of companion files (see Portion thirteen): o a profile specification document, which defines a set of payload type codes as well as their mapping to payload formats (e.g., media encodings). A profile may outline extensions or modifications to RTP that happen to be distinct to a specific class of purposes.

In the event the neighborhood person clicks the interface widget to disable keep mode, the disableHold() method is referred to as to begin the entire process of restoring regular features.

RFC 3550 RTP July 2003 working with the bare minimum interval, that might be every 5 seconds on the standard. Each and every third interval (15 seconds), 1 additional merchandise might be included in the SDES packet. Seven out of eight periods This might be the Title product, and each eighth time (2 minutes) It might be the EMAIL merchandise. When numerous apps run in live performance employing cross-software binding by way of a typical CNAME for each participant, for example inside of a multimedia convention made up of an RTP session for every medium, the extra SDES info Can be despatched in just one RTP session. The opposite periods would carry only the CNAME product. Especially, this strategy really should be placed on the many periods of a layered encoding scheme (see Section two.four). 6.four Sender and Receiver Experiences RTP receivers deliver reception top quality comments making use of RTCP report packets which may take one of two sorts dependent upon if the receiver is likewise a sender. The sole difference between the sender report (SR) and receiver report (RR) varieties, Aside from the packet kind code, would be that the sender report includes a twenty-byte sender data section to be used by Energetic senders. The SR is issued if a internet site has despatched any data packets over the interval due to the fact issuing the last report or maybe the previous 1, if not the RR is issued.

o When a BYE packet from Yet another participant is gained, members is incremented by 1 regardless of whether that participant exists during the member table or not, and when SSRC sampling is in use, irrespective of whether or not the BYE SSRC could be included in the sample. customers is just not incremented when other RTCP packets or RTP packets are acquired, but just for BYE packets. In the same way, avg_rtcp_size is up to date only for obtained BYE packets. senders will not be current when RTP packets get there; it continues to be 0. o Transmission from the BYE packet then follows the rules for transmitting a regular RTCP packet, as above. This permits BYE packets to generally be despatched without delay, yet controls their complete bandwidth usage. Within the worst case, This might bring about RTCP control packets to utilize two times the bandwidth as regular (ten%) -- five% for non-BYE RTCP packets and 5% for BYE. A participant that doesn't desire to look forward to the above system to allow transmission of the BYE packet May possibly leave the group with out sending a BYE in the slightest degree. That participant will ultimately be timed out by another team associates. Schulzrinne, et al. Specifications Track [Site 33]

Multimedia session: A set of concurrent RTP classes among the a common group of participants. As an example, a videoconference (which is a multimedia session) may perhaps incorporate an audio RTP session along with a video RTP session. RTP session: An Affiliation amongst a list of members speaking with RTP. A participant could possibly be involved with numerous RTP periods at the same time. Inside of a multimedia session, Every single medium is typically carried in the different RTP session with its personal RTCP packets Except the the encoding itself multiplexes several media into one details stream. A participant distinguishes numerous RTP sessions by reception of different sessions employing distinct pairs of spot transportation addresses, where a pair of transportation addresses comprises a single community address as well as a set of ports for RTP and RTCP. All participants in an RTP session might share a typical vacation spot transportation tackle pair, as in the case of IP multicast, or perhaps the pairs can be distinct for each participant, as in the situation of individual unicast network addresses and port pairs. Inside the unicast situation, a participant may possibly acquire from all other contributors during the session using the similar set of ports, or may well use a definite pair of ports for each. Schulzrinne, et al. Specifications Monitor [Page nine]

Packets are sequence-numbered and timestamped for reassembly when they get there from order. This allows info sent utilizing RTP be shipped on transports that don't guarantee purchasing and even guarantee shipping in any way.

From this level on, the microphone is re-engaged as well as remote user is Yet again ready to hear the neighborhood consumer, and speak to them.

The interarrival jitter, and that is calculated as the typical interarrival time between successive packets while in the RTP stream.

(India, historical) A document or register consisting of a set of unfastened sheets submitted over a string or tied up in a very fabric.

We've began allowing our associates find out about these updates throughout many channels. You could find out more listed here: Take note: We have edited this post to supply added facts.

The interarrival jitter field is barely a snapshot from the jitter at the time of the report and is not meant to be taken quantitatively. Rather, it is meant for comparison across several reports from a person receiver with time or from numerous receivers, e.g., inside of a solitary community, simultaneously. To permit comparison across receivers, it is vital the the jitter be calculated in accordance with the very same formula by all receivers. Since the jitter calculation is predicated within the RTP timestamp which signifies the instant when the 1st information during the packet was sampled, any variation inside the hold off in between that sampling fast and the time the packet is transmitted will have an affect on the resulting jitter that is certainly calculated. This kind of variation in hold off would happen for audio packets of various length. It will also take place for movie encodings since the timestamp is identical for all the packets of one frame but Individuals packets are usually not all transmitted concurrently. The variation in delay till transmission does reduce the accuracy in the jitter calculation being a measure on the habits from the network by itself, however it is appropriate to incorporate Given that the receiver buffer ought to accommodate it. If the jitter calculation is applied for a comparative evaluate, the (consistent) element as a result of variation in delay until transmission subtracts out so that a change during the Schulzrinne, et al. Benchmarks Observe [Webpage forty four]

/message /verifyErrors The phrase in the example sentence doesn't match the entry term. The sentence has offensive articles. Cancel Submit Many thanks! Your comments will probably be reviewed. http://sttd.ac.id #verifyErrors message

RFC 3550 RTP July 2003 2.1 Basic Multicast Audio Meeting A Operating group on the IETF satisfies to debate the latest protocol document, using the IP multicast expert services of the web for voice communications. By way of some allocation mechanism the Performing team chair obtains a multicast team tackle and set of ports. Just one port is useful for audio data, and the opposite is useful for Command (RTCP) packets. This handle and port information is dispersed to the supposed contributors. If privateness is preferred, the data and Manage packets might be encrypted as specified in Portion nine.1, by which case an encryption essential have to also be created and dispersed. The exact details of such allocation and distribution mechanisms are further than the scope of RTP. The audio conferencing software used by Each and every conference participant sends audio facts in modest chunks of, say, 20 ms length. Each chunk of audio data is preceded by an RTP header; RTP header and facts are in turn contained in a UDP packet. The RTP header suggests what type of audio encoding (for instance PCM, ADPCM or LPC) is contained in Each and every packet so that senders can alter the encoding in the course of a meeting, as an example, to support a fresh participant that may be connected via a very low-bandwidth link or respond to indications of network congestion.

 

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“The 5-Second Trick For rtp”

Leave a Reply

Gravatar